What Does P2763 Mean?
The transmission control module (TCM) has detected an abnormally high voltage in the torque converter clutch pressure control solenoid circuit. This indicates a potential short to voltage, open circuit, or internal solenoid failure preventing proper lockup control.

Diagnostic Steps
1
Step 1: Inspect transmission external wiring harness and TCC solenoid connector for damage, corrosion, or pinched wires
2
Step 2: Disconnect TCC pressure control solenoid connector and measure resistance across solenoid terminals (typically 3-30 ohms depending on manufacturer)
3
Step 3: Check for short to voltage by measuring voltage at harness side of connector with key on, engine off (should read 0V)
4
Step 4: Perform continuity test on wiring between TCM and solenoid to identify opens or shorts
5
Step 5: If wiring and solenoid test normal, substitute known-good TCM to verify module failure

Vehicle may experience harsh shifting, poor fuel economy, or inability to achieve torque converter lockup. Generally safe to drive short distances but may cause transmission overheating with extended use.
